Latest Patents

Among his notable inventions is a disc brake system featuring spring clip pad holders. This clever design incorporates a simple wire form clip that securely holds the brake pad against the caliper pistons, effectively preventing brake drag and rattle. The manufacturing process for this pad holder is not only cost-effective but also allows for easy installation that does not require removal of the disc or caliper. This design enables mechanics to replace the pad holder effortlessly by applying sufficient upward force, making it a significant improvement in convenience and efficiency.

Another critical patent is for a brake disk that features a unique arm configuration connecting the inner hub and the outer rub area. This design plays a crucial role in relieving stress caused by heat during braking, thus preventing warping. Moreover, the arms are strategically shaped to distribute stress evenly, thereby minimizing the risk of cracks or fractures during the braking cycle.
